Does hemorrhoidectomy affect pregnancy preparation?

Hemorrhoidectomy is a common method of treating hemorrhoids by removing hemorrhoidal tissue. Hemorrhoidectomy surgery itself has no direct impact on pregnancy preparation, but the recovery period after the surgery takes a certain amount of time and may affect your sexual life. If you are trying to conceive, it is recommended to consult your doctor before surgery to understand the recovery time and sexual activity recommendations after surgery so that you can make a reasonable decision. At the same time, hemorrhoid surgery may require local anesthesia, and you may experience pain and discomfort after the surgery. You may also need to avoid sexual intercourse during this period. It is best to follow your doctor’s advice and consider preparing for pregnancy during the recovery period after surgery.
